The Pocatello Cross Country Ski Foundation (PXCSF) is a non-profit organization committed to promoting and improving Nordic skiing for all levels of experience in Pocatello. We believe that a quality ski experience for novice and expert skiers depends on well maintained trails with excellent grooming. PXCSF assists the City of Pocatello to operate Mink Creek Nordic Area with volunteer labor and equipment for trail maintenance and grooming. PXCSF also promotes local skiing through events such as the Potato Cup race, Fun Race Series and fall Trail Runs with volunteer work days. We also support both masters and junior ski programs based on interest.
